Brighton and Hove Albion and Nottingham Forest will battle for three points in a Premier League matchday 28 clash on Sunday (March 1st). The game will be played at The Amex Stadium.

The hosts will be looking to build on the morale-boosting 2-0 away win they registered over Brentford last weekend. Both goals were scored in the first half, with Diego Gomez breaking the deadlock on the half-hour mark while Danny Welbeck doubled their lead in first-half injury time.

Forest, meanwhile, fell to a 2-1 defeat at home to Fenerbahce in the second leg of their UEFA Europa League playoff tie. Kerem Akturgoglu scored a brace to put the visitors on the cusp of completing a spectacular comeback. But halftime substitute Callum Hudson-Odoi pulled one back midway through the second half to help his side advance with a 4-2 aggregate victory and book a round-of-16 date with Midtjylland.

The Tricky Trees will shift their focus to the domestic scene, where their last game saw them fall to a heartbreaking last-gasp 1-0 loss at home to Liverpool.

The defeat left them in 17th spot in the standings, having garnered 27 points from as many games. Brighton are 14th on 34 points.


Brighton vs Nottingham Forest Head-to-Head and Key Numbers

  • The two sides have clashed on 45 occasions in the past. Nottingham Forest lead 19-14.
  • Their most recent clash came in November 2025 when Brighton claimed a 2-0 away win in the reverse fixture.
  • Forest are winless in their last five away head-to-head games against Brighton in the league (three losses).
  • Seven of Brighton’s last eight EPL games have produced under 2.5 goals.
  • Brighton have won just one of their last seven home games (four draws).
